General
Sim Type | Single Sim, GSM | Single Sim, GSM |
Dual Sim | No | No |
Sim Size | Nano SIM | Nano SIM |
Device Type | Smartphone | Smartphone |
Release Date | September, 2016 | April, 2015 |
Design
Dimensions | 67.09 x 138.3 x 7.1 mm | 70.59 x 146.4 x 9.6 mm |
Weight | 138 g | 160 g |
Display
Type | Color IPS LCD Screen (16M colors Colors) | Color LCD Screen (16M colors Colors) |
Touch | Yes | Yes |
Size | 4.7 inches, 750 x 1334 pixels | 5 inches, 1080 x 1920 pixels |
Aspect Ratio | 16:9 | 16:9 |
PPI | ~ 326 PPI | ~ 441 PPI |
Screen to Body Ratio | ~ 65.6% | |
Features | Ion-strengthened glass, oleophobic coating Screen Protection | Corning Gorilla Glass 3 (TBC) Screen Protection |
Memory
RAM | 2 GB | 2 GB |
Storage | 32 GB | 32 GB |
Card Slot | No | Yes, upto 128 GB |
Connectivity
GPRS | Yes | Yes |
EDGE | Yes | Yes |
3G | Yes 1 Mbps Download | Yes |
4G | Yes | Yes |
VoLTE | Yes | |
Wifi | Yes, with wifi-hotspot | Yes, with wifi-hotspot |
Bluetooth | Yes, v4.2 | Yes, v4.0 |
USB | Yes, Proprietary v2.0 | Yes, microUSB-MHL v2.0 |
USB Features | USB on-the-go |
Extra
GPS | Yes, with A-GPS Support | Yes, with A-GPS Support |
Fingerprint Sensor | Yes | |
Sensors | Accelerometer, Gyroscope, Proximity, Compass, Barometer | Accelerometer, Gyroscope, Compass |
3.5mm Headphone Jack | No | Yes |
NFC | Yes | Yes |
Extra | HDMI, DLNA, TV Out | |
Water Resistance | Yes, 1 m upto 30 min | |
IP Rating | IP67 | |
Dust Resistant | Yes |
Camera
Rear Camera | 12 MP with autofocus | 13 MP with autofocus |
Features | Face detection, Smile detection, Geo tagging, Panorama, Touch to focus | Face detection, Smile detection, Geo tagging, Panorama |
Video Recording | 4K @ 30 fps UHD | 1080p @ 60 fps FHD |
Flash | Yes, Quad-LED | Yes, Dual LED |
Front Camera | 7 MP | 5 MP |
Technical
OS | iOS v10.0.1, upgradable to v12 | Android v5.0 (Lollipop) |
Chipset | Apple Fusion A10 | Qualcomm Snapdragon 615 |
CPU | 2.34 GHz, Quad Core Processor | 1 GHz, Octa Core Processor |
GPU | PowerVR Series7XT Plus (Six-Core graphics) | Adreno 405 |
Java | No | Yes, via 3rd party |
Browser | Yes, supports HTML5 (Safari) | Yes, supports HTML |
Multimedia
Supports | MMS, iMessage, Voice Commands | MMS |
Yes, with Push Email | Yes, with Push Email | |
Music | MP3, WAV, AAX+, AIFF | MP3, eAAC+, WMA, WAV, FLAC |
Video | MP4, H.264 | DivX, XviD, MP4, H.264, WMV |
FM Radio | No | Yes |
Document Reader | Yes | Yes |
Battery
Type | Non-Removable Battery | Non-Removable Battery |
Size | 1960 mAh, Li-ion Battery | 2840 mAh, Li-Po Battery |
Music Playback Time | 40 hours |
